Between 1936 and 1940, William Warren Barbour ran in 3 U.S. Senate elections, winning 2 and losing 1. Barbour's biggest single-election total was 1,029,331 votes, in the 1940 U.S. Senate election in New Jersey. Barbour's closest win came in the 1938 U.S. Senate election in New Jersey, decided by 112,508 votes.

Election history
| Year | Office | Result | Votes | Opponent(s)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1940 | U.S. SenateNew Jersey | Won | 1,029,33155.11% | James H. Cromwell Macalister Coleman James A. Tumulty Mary E. Dooner Edson R. Leach Harry Santhouse George Breitman |
| 1938 | U.S. SenateNew Jersey · Special | Won | 816,66752.98% | William H. J. Ely |
| 1936 | U.S. SenateNew Jersey | Lost | 740,08844.34% | William H. Smathers Fred Turner Herman F. Niessner Herbert Coley Malcom G. Thomas George E. Bopp |
